Most people searching for Waterbomb Busan 2026 are looking to confirm two things: where the venue is, and whether they can book tickets now. As of July 10, 2026, the answer is: the date and operating hours have been confirmed, but the venue has not yet been officially announced. This sentence is the starting point of this page. If you delay preparations because the venue hasn't been revealed, accommodation and transportation will already be expensive once it is announced.
The Busan edition differs in nature from Seoul. While Seoul is held over three days (July 24-26), allowing you to choose a date, Busan is only on Saturday, August 8. A one-day festival offers no flexibility in choosing a date; instead, that day's itinerary, accommodation, and return trip plans largely determine satisfaction. Moreover, early August in Busan is peak season for the entire city.
| Item | Details |
|---|---|
| Date | August 8, 2026 (Sat), One day |
| Operating Hours | 1 PM ~ 10 PM (Approx. 540 minutes of viewing) |
| Venue | Officially Unannounced (As of July 10, 2026) |
| Age Requirement | 19 years old and above — Born before December 31, 2007 |
| ID Check | Physical ID required for entry |
| Ticket | 1-DAY Full Price 165,000 KRW (Price increases in stages) |
| Host | MAIDON Co., Ltd. |
| Official Channels | waterbombfestival.com, Instagram @waterbomb_official |

Until the 2026 venue is announced, last year serves as a useful reference point. Waterbomb Busan 2025 was held on July 26 at Busan Port Pier 1, attracting approximately 20,000 people. Busan Port Pier 1 is located in Jungang-dong 4-ga, Jung-gu, Busan, within the North Port Redevelopment Zone.
Based on this location, accessibility is quite good. Using the elevated pedestrian deck (skyway) connecting Busan Station to the International Passenger Terminal allows for walking without waiting for traffic lights, and most of the section is flat, with some parts having moving walkways.
The map pin below on this page also points to Busan Port Pier 1, the 2025 venue, not the confirmed 2026 venue. Use it only for planning your itinerary in advance. However, this is merely an example from last year. There has been no official announcement that the 2026 Busan edition will be held at the same venue. | Item | Why it's needed |
|---|---|
| Phone waterproof case | Ticket confirmation, payment, communication, and photography are all done with a phone. Choose a product with a sturdy lock. |
| Aqua shoes or strap sandals | Shoes that come off or slip on wet ground pose a risk of injury. |
| Spare top and thin towel | Moving around while wet after the 10 PM end time can cause your body temperature to drop. |
| Ziploc bag/waterproof pouch | To store wallet, ID, car keys, and power bank separately. |
| Sunscreen, hat, drinking water | Even if you get wet, you'll still be exposed to sun and heat during waiting times. |
| Power bank | Slow communication in a crowd leads to faster battery drain. |
Thin white clothing can become transparent when wet, and cotton materials don't dry quickly. Choose quick-drying materials, but be sure to pack one dry top to change into for your journey home.

The Busan Sea Festival is held annually in early August across several beaches in Busan, including Haeundae, Songjeong, Gwangalli, Dadaepo, Ilgwang, and Songdo. This means there's a high possibility of overlap with Waterbomb Busan, and consequently, accommodation and transportation fill up quickly. Conversely, a 2-day, 1-night plan, spending one day at Waterbomb and the next at the beach, would be a natural combination.
Check the official announcements from the Busan Festival Organizing Committee for detailed schedules and beach-specific programs for the 2026 Busan Sea Festival.

When will the venue be announced? The official announcement date has not been foretold. The Waterbomb official Instagram and ticketing site announcements are the fastest. Once the venue is out, re-calculate transportation and accommodation locations.
Can minors attend? No. It is for ages 19 and above; only those born before December 31, 2007, can enter. Physical ID will be checked upon entry.
Ticket prices differ across articles. This is because prices increase in stages. Early bird tickets are the cheapest, and once sold out, it moves to the next tier. The 1-DAY full price is 165,000 KRW. For the current actual price, check the ticketing site's display.
What happens in case of rain? Operating policies follow the announcements for each edition. Since it's a water festival, it won't be canceled due to rain, but safety measures will be based on announcements on the day of the event.
Can I bring a water gun? Permitted items and size restrictions are specified in the announcements for each edition. Be sure to check the entry guide after booking. On-site sales or rentals may also be available.
